Written by Reverend Tony Ponticello Saturday, 31 March 2012 12:00 It is a fact that I perceive errors both in myself and others. It is our sacred mission to correct errors. How do we correct errors that we perceive in others? Obviously, we don’t do it by ourselves. We do it with the Holy Spirit’s help. There is technically no difference between perceiving an error in ourselves or perceiving it in another. An error has been discerned. That’s the important thing. A discerned error is turned over to the Holy Spirit. Help is asked for. We ask for new corrected perceptions. We also ask Holy Spirit if there is something specific, perhaps something physical, that we should do. Maybe there are words that will need to be said to certain people. If any of these things are true, we can be confident that we will be told. “Let us not rest content until the world has joined our changed perception. Let us not be satisfied until forgiveness has been made complete. And let us not attempt to change our function. We must save the world. For we who made it must behold it through the eyes of Christ, that what was made to die be restored to Everlasting Life.” (OrEd.WkBk.SpTp241.5) I am a sacred missionary walking through what appears to be a physical life. I can enjoy the beauty and the pleasure of this life, but I should never delude myself into thinking that these pleasures will, in any way, fulfill and satisfy me. I can never “rest content” here. Only the completion of my sacred mission will fulfill and satisfy me. My mission is to correct the errors that appear in the world. It doesn’t matter where they appear. It doesn’t matter if they appear to be in the inner or the outer because, “... the inner is the cause of the outer.” (OrEd.WkBk.31.2) If the error is perceived in one of the places, it will be in the other as well. If I see it outside it is also inside. If I discern it inside there will be outer manifestations of it too. I think that makes our mission much easier, don’t you? Rejoice and be glad. The errors areeverywhere! We can’t miss them. There is no correction if I am trying to convince a brother, a sister, or myself that there is an outer error that doesn’t exist in the inner me. “Teach no one that he is what you would not want to be. Your brother is the mirror in which you will see the image of yourself as long as perception lasts. And perception will last until the Sonship knows itself as whole.” (OrEd.Tx.7.73) It is an error to not see that we are whole, that we are one child of God. That’s a lack of love. That is a perception that needs to be changed in us and in the world. However, that’s not really a big deal, because if we change it in ourselves it automatically changes it in the world. I remember, “... the inner is the cause of the outer.” So what about those errors that I see in my brothers and sisters, especially when I don’t see them in myself? What do I need to understand so I can escape from this dilemma? “The world but demonstrates an ancient truth-you will believe that others do to you exactly what you think you did to them. But once deluded into blaming them, you will not see the cause of what they do because you want the guilt to rest on them. “(OrEd.Tx.27.9.81) I don’t think that the errors are in me, only because I want the guilt to rest on them, the “others.” This A Course In Miracles is so damn uncompromising. It is the privilege of the forgiven to forgive. jcim.net/acim_us/TxtChap-1-1.php?dig=error III. Healing as Release from Fear 52 The emphasis will now be on healing. The miracle is the means, the Atonement is the principle, and healing is the result. Those who speak of a miracle of healing are combining two orders of reality inappropriately. Healing isnot a miracle. The Atonement or the final miracle is a remedy, while any type of healing is a result. The kind of error to which Atonement is applied is irrelevant. Essentially, all healing is the release from fear. To undertake this, youcannot be fearful yourself. You do not understand healing because of your own fear. 53 A major step in the Atonement plan is to undo error at all levels. Illness, which is really not-right-mindedness, is the result of level confusion in the sense that it always entails the belief that what is amiss in one level can adversely affect another. We have constantly referred to miracles as the means of correcting level confusion, and all mistakes must be corrected at the level on which they occur. Only the mind is capable of error. The body can acterroneously, but this is only because it is responding to mis-thought. The body cannot create, and the belief that itcan, a fundamental error, produces all physical symptoms… ...56 The body, if properly understood, shares the invulnerability of the Atonement to two-edged application. This is not because the body is a miracle but because it is not inherently open to misinterpretation. The body is merely a fact in human experience. Its abilities can be and frequently are over-evaluated. However, it is almost impossible to deny its existence. Those who do so are engaging in a particularly unworthy form of denial. The term unworthy here implies simply that it is not necessary to protect the mind by denying the unmindful. [There is little doubt that the mind can miscreate.] If one denies this unfortunate aspect of the minds power, one is also denying the power itself… ...59 The value of the Atonement does not lie in the manner in which it is expressed. In fact, if it is truly used, it will inevitably be expressed in whatever way is most helpful to the receiver[, not the giver]. This means that a miracle, to attain its full efficacy, must be expressed in a language which the recipient can understand without fear. It does not follow by any means that this is the highest level of communication of which he is capable. It does mean, however, that it is the highest level of communication of which he is capable now. The whole aim of the miracle is to raise the level of communication, not to impose regression in the improper sense upon it… 61 It is essential to remember that only the mind can create. Implicit in this is the corollary that correction belongs at the thought level. To repeat an earlier statement and to extend it somewhat, the Soul is already perfect and therefore does not require correction. The body does not really exist except as a learning device for the mind. This learning device is not subject to errors of its own because it was created but is not creating. It should be obvious, then, that correcting the creator or inducing it to give up its miscreations is the only application of creative ability which is truly meaningful. 63 We have already said that the miracle is an expression of miracle-mindedness. Miracle-mindedness merely means right-mindedness in the sense that we are now using it. The right-minded neither exalt nor depreciate the mind of the miracle worker or the miracle receiver. However, as a creative act, the miracle need not await the right-mindedness of the receiver. In fact, its purpose is to restore him to his right mind. It is essential, however, that the miracle worker be in his right mind or he will be unable to reestablish right-mindedness in someone else. 64 The healer who relies on his own readiness is endangering his understanding. He is perfectly safe as long as he is completely unconcerned about his readiness but maintains a consistent trust in mine. If your miracle working propensities are not functioning properly, it is always because fear has intruded on your right-mindedness and has literally upset it (or turned it upside-down). All forms of not-right-mindedness are the result of refusal to accept the Atonement for yourself. If the miracle worker does accept it, he places himself in a position to recognize that those who need to be healed are simply those who have not realized that right-mindedness is healing. 65 The sole responsibility of the miracle worker is to accept the Atonement for himself. This means that he recognizes that mind is the only creative level and that its errors are healed by the Atonement. Once he accepts this, his mind can only heal. By denying his mind any destructive potential and reinstating its purely constructive powers, he has placed himself in a position where he can undo the level confusion of others. The message he then gives to others is the truth that their minds are similarly constructive and that their miscreations cannot hurt them. By affirming this, the miracle worker releases the mind from over-evaluating its own learning device (the body) and restores the mind to its true position as the learner. 66 It should be emphasized again that the body does not learn any more than it creates. As a learning device, it merely follows the learner, but if it is falsely endowed with self-initiative, it becomes a serious obstruction to the very learning it should facilitate. Only the mind is capable of illumination. The Soul is already illuminated, and the body in itself is too dense. The mind, however, can bring its illumination to the body by recognizing that density is the opposite of intelligence and therefore unamenable to independent learning. It is, however, easily brought into alignment with a mind which has learned to look beyond density toward light. 67 Corrective learning always begins with the awakening of the Spiritual eye and the turning away from the belief in physical sight. The reason this so often entails fear is because man is afraid of what his Spiritual eye will see. We said before that the Spiritual eye cannot see error and is capable only of looking beyond it to the defense of Atonement. There is no doubt that the Spiritual eye does produce extreme discomfort by what it sees. Yet what man forgets is that the discomfort is not the final outcome of its perception. When the Spiritual eye is permitted to look upon the defilement of the altar, it also looks immediately toward the Atonement. 68 Nothing the Spiritual eye perceives can induce fear. Everything that results from accurate spiritual awareness is merely channelized toward correction. Discomfort is aroused only to bring the need for correction forcibly into awareness. What the physical eye sees is not corrective nor can it be corrected by any device which can be seen physically. As long as a man believes in what his physical sight tells him, all his corrective behavior will be misdirected. The real vision is obscured because man cannot endure to see his own defiled altar.
